- Title
Micromonospora violae sp. nov., isolated from a root of Viola philippica Car.
- Authors
Zhang, Yuejing; Liu, Hui; Zhang, Xinhui; Wang, Shurui; Liu, Chongxi; Yu, Chao; Wang, Xiangjing; Xiang, Wensheng
- Abstract
A novel actinomycete, designated strain NEAU-zh8, was isolated from a root of Viola philippica Car collected in China and characterized using a polyphasic approach. 16S rRNA gene sequence similarity studies showed that strain NEAU-zh8 belongs to the genus Micromonospora, being most closely related to Micromonospora chokoriensis 2-9(6) (99.9 %), Micromonospora saelicesensis Lupac 09 (99.3 %) and Micromonospora lupini Lupac 14N (99.0 %). gyrB gene analysis also indicated that strain NEAU-zh8 should be assigned to the genus Micromonospora. The cell-wall peptidoglycan consisted of meso-diaminopimelic acid and glycine. The major menaquinones were MK-10(H), MK-10(H) and MK-10(H). The phospholipid profile contained diphosphatidylglycerol, phosphatidylethanolamine and phosphatidylinositol. The major fatty acids were iso-C, C and C 10-methyl. A combination of DNA-DNA hybridization results and some physiological and biochemical properties indicated that strain NEAU-zh8 could be readily distinguished from the closest phylogenetic relatives. Therefore, it is proposed that strain NEAU-zh8 represents a novel Micromonospora species, for which the name Micromonospora violae sp. nov. is proposed. The type strain is NEAU-zh8 (=CGMCC 4.7102=DSM 45888).
